#377fe0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#377fe0 is composed of 21.6% red, 49.8% green and 87.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.4% cyan, 43.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 214.4 degrees, a saturation of 73.2% and a lightness of 54.7%. #377fe0 color hex could be obtained by blending #6efeff with #0000c1.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#377fe0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010204 is the darkest color, while #f2f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#377fe0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#878b90 is the less saturated color, while #1c7bfb is the most saturated one.
